Beef-Stuffed Mushrooms
Beef-Stuffed Mushrooms are filled with a seasoned blend of ground beef, onions, garlic, and breadcrumbs enriched with cream, then baked until the caps are tender and the tops lightly browned. A touch of chili powder adds gentle heat that pairs beautifully with buttery mushroom caps. Serve these bite-size appetizers hot for parties, game days, or holiday spreads.

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
- 2
Remove the mushroom stems and chop them.
- 3
Combine the ground beef, onion, and garlic in a saucepan over medium heat and cook until the beef is no longer pink; drain. Mix in the chopped mushroom stems, 1 tablespoon butter, bread crumbs, salt, and pepper. Cook, stirring often, for 5 minutes. Remove from the heat and stir in the cream.
- 4
Dip the mushroom caps in 1/4 cup melted butter and generously stuff them with the meat mixture. Arrange the stuffed mushrooms in a baking dish. Sprinkle with chili powder.
- 5
Bake in the preheated oven for 20 to 25 minutes.
